KR100505210B1 - 에러 정정장치 및 방법 - Google Patents
에러 정정장치 및 방법 Download PDFInfo
- Publication number
- KR100505210B1 KR100505210B1 KR10-2002-0013152A KR20020013152A KR100505210B1 KR 100505210 B1 KR100505210 B1 KR 100505210B1 KR 20020013152 A KR20020013152 A KR 20020013152A KR 100505210 B1 KR100505210 B1 KR 100505210B1
- Authority
- KR
- South Korea
- Prior art keywords
- error
- polynomial
- syndrome
- correction
- burst
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
Classifications
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11B—INFORMATION STORAGE BASED ON RELATIVE MOVEMENT BETWEEN RECORD CARRIER AND TRANSDUCER
- G11B20/00—Signal processing not specific to the method of recording or reproducing; Circuits therefor
- G11B20/10—Digital recording or reproducing
- G11B20/18—Error detection or correction; Testing, e.g. of drop-outs
Landscapes
- Engineering & Computer Science (AREA)
- Signal Processing (AREA)
- Error Detection And Correction (AREA)
Abstract
Description
Claims (7)
- 광 디스크에서 재생된 블록 데이터의 신드롬을 발생하는 신드롬 발생부;인너 정정시 정정 불가능신호가 입력될 경우에 상기 광 디스크에서 재생된 블록 데이터의 버스트 에러를 검출하고 아우터 정정시 상기 검출한 버스트 에러에 따라 이레이저 다항식을 발생하는 이레이저 다항식 발생수단;인너 정정시 상기 신드롬 발생부가 발생한 신드롬에 따라 에러위치 다항식을 발생하고 에러 정정이 불가능할 경우에 정정 불가능신호를 발생하여 상기 이레이저 다항식 발생수단에 입력시키며, 아우터 정정시 상기 이레이저 다항식 발생수단이 이레이저 다항식을 발생하지 않을 경우에 상기 신드롬에 따라 에러위치 다항식을 발생하고 이레이저 다항식을 발생할 경우에 그 이레이저 다항식을 초기 값으로 하여 상기 신드롬에 따라 에러위치 다항식을 발생하는 에러위치 다항식 발생부;상기 에러위치 다항식 발생부가 발생한 에러위치 다항식으로 에러 값과 에러위치를 발생하는 에러 값/에러위치 발생부; 및상기 에러 값/에러위치 발생부가 발생한 에러 값과 에러위치에 따라 에러를 정정하는 에러 정정부로 구성된 에러 정정장치.
- 제 1 항에 있어서, 상기 이레이저 다항식 발생수단은;상기 신드롬 발생부 및 에러위치 다항식 발생부가 처리하고 있는 로우의 데이터를 저장하는 1 로우 데이터 저장부;상기 에러위치 다항식 발생부로부터 정정 불가능 신호가 입력될 경우에 상기 1 로우 데이터 저장부에 저장된 1 로우의 데이터를 입력받아 버스트 에러의 시작위치와 종료위치를 검출하는 버스트 에러 검출부;상기 버스트 에러 검출부가 검출한 버스트 에러의 시작위치와 종료위치를 저장하는 버스트 에러 저장부; 및아우터 정정시 상기 버스트 에러 저장부에 저장된 버스트 에러의 시작위치 및 종료위치에 따라 이레이저 다항식을 발생하여 상기 에러위치 다항식 발생부에 입력시키는 이레이저 다항식 발생부로 구성됨을 특징으로 하는 에러 정정장치.
- 제 2 항에 있어서, 상기 버스트 에러 검출부는;상기 1 로우 데이터 저장부로부터 입력받은 데이터가 미리 설정된 바이트 이상 동일한 값이 연속될 경우에 버스트 에러로 검출하는 것을 특징으로 하는 에러 정정장치.
- 인너 정정시 광 디스크에서 재생된 블록 데이터를 신드롬 발생부가 1 로우씩 입력하여 신드롬을 계산하는 제 1 과정;상기 제 1 과정에서 계산한 신드롬의 값으로 에러위치 다항식 발생부가 에러위치 다항식을 발생하여 에러의 정정이 가능한지의 여부를 판단하는 제 2 과정;상기 제 2 과정에서 에러 정정이 가능할 경우에 에러를 정정하는 제 3 과정;상기 제 2 과정에서 에러 정정이 불가능할 경우에 이레이저 다항식 발생수단이 버스트 에러의 시작위치 및 종료위치를 검출하여 저장하는 제 4 과정;아우터 정정시 상기 블록 데이터를 신드롬 발생부가 1 칼럼씩 입력하여 신드롬을 계산하는 제 5 과정;상기 제 5 과정에서 신드롬 발생부가 신드롬을 계산하는 칼럼의 데이터에 버스트 에러가 있을 경우에 상기 이레이저 다항식 발생수단이 상기 저장한 버스트 에러의 시작위치 및 종료위치에 따라 이레이저 다항식을 발생하는 제 6 과정;상기 제 6 과정에서 이레이저 다항식을 발생할 경우에 그 이레이저 다항식의 값을 초기 값으로 하여 에러위치 다항식 발생부가 상기 제 5 과정에서 계산한 신드롬에 따라 에러위치 다항식을 발생하고 이레이저 다항식을 발생하지 않을 경우에 상기 신드롬에 따라서만 에러위치 다항식을 발생하는 제 7 과정;상기 제 7 과정에서 발생한 에러위치 다항식에 따라 에러를 정정하는 제 8 과정으로 이루어짐을 특징으로 하는 에러 정정방법.
- 제 4 항에 있어서, 상기 제 4 과정은;에러의 정정이 불가능할 경우에 그 에러 정정이 불가능하다고 판단한 로우 데이터에서 버스트 에러 검출부가 버스트 에러를 검출하는 제 11 과정; 및상기 제 11 과정에서 검출한 버스트 에러를 버스트 에러 저장부가 저장하는 제 12 과정으로 이루어짐을 특징으로 하는 에러 정정방법.
- 제 5 항에 있어서, 상기 제 12 과정은;로우 데이터에서 미리 설정된 바이트 이상 동일한 값이 연속되는 위치를 버스트 에러로 검출하는 것을 특징으로 하는 에러 정정방법.
- 제 4 항에 있어서, 상기 제 6 과정은;상기 제 4 과정에서 저장한 버스트 에러로 칼럼의 데이터의 버스트 에러 여부를 판단하여 이레이저 다항식을 발생하는 것을 특징으로 하는 에러 정정방법.
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
KR10-2002-0013152A KR100505210B1 (ko) | 2002-03-12 | 2002-03-12 | 에러 정정장치 및 방법 |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
KR10-2002-0013152A KR100505210B1 (ko) | 2002-03-12 | 2002-03-12 | 에러 정정장치 및 방법 |
Publications (2)
Publication Number | Publication Date |
---|---|
KR20030073531A KR20030073531A (ko) | 2003-09-19 |
KR100505210B1 true KR100505210B1 (ko) | 2005-08-04 |
Family
ID=32224357
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
KR10-2002-0013152A Expired - Fee Related KR100505210B1 (ko) | 2002-03-12 | 2002-03-12 | 에러 정정장치 및 방법 |
Country Status (1)
Country | Link |
---|---|
KR (1) | KR100505210B1 (ko) |
Citations (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PS62246179A (ja) * | 1986-04-18 | 1987-10-27 | Olympus Optical Co Ltd | 情報記録装置 |
JPH03149924A (ja) * | 1989-11-06 | 1991-06-26 | Mitsubishi Electric Corp | 誤り訂正復号装置 |
JPH05274820A (ja) * | 1992-03-24 | 1993-10-22 | Kyocera Corp | 誤り訂正装置 |
KR960003123A (ko) * | 1994-06-16 | 1996-01-26 | 사또 후미오 | 에러정정장치 및 방법 |
KR960015535A (ko) * | 1994-10-24 | 1996-05-22 | 에러 정정 방법 및 장치 | |
KR19980027713A (ko) * | 1996-10-17 | 1998-07-15 | 김광호 | 이레이저 정정 능력을 갖는 리드-솔로몬 부호의 복호 장치 및 방법 |
KR19980059945A (ko) * | 1996-12-31 | 1998-10-07 | 구자홍 | 에러정정 장치 및 방법 |
KR19980059974A (ko) * | 1996-12-31 | 1998-10-07 | 구자홍 | 이종 광 디스크 에러정정 회로 |
KR19980065723A (ko) * | 1997-01-14 | 1998-10-15 | 김광호 | 디지탈 비디오 디스크 시스템의 데이타 처리 방법 및 장치 |
KR100335482B1 (ko) * | 1994-08-17 | 2002-11-27 | 삼성전자 주식회사 | 에러정정시스템 |
-
2002
- 2002-03-12 KR KR10-2002-0013152A patent/KR100505210B1/ko not_active Expired - Fee Related
Patent Citations (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PS62246179A (ja) * | 1986-04-18 | 1987-10-27 | Olympus Optical Co Ltd | 情報記録装置 |
JPH03149924A (ja) * | 1989-11-06 | 1991-06-26 | Mitsubishi Electric Corp | 誤り訂正復号装置 |
JPH05274820A (ja) * | 1992-03-24 | 1993-10-22 | Kyocera Corp | 誤り訂正装置 |
KR960003123A (ko) * | 1994-06-16 | 1996-01-26 | 사또 후미오 | 에러정정장치 및 방법 |
KR100335482B1 (ko) * | 1994-08-17 | 2002-11-27 | 삼성전자 주식회사 | 에러정정시스템 |
KR960015535A (ko) * | 1994-10-24 | 1996-05-22 | 에러 정정 방법 및 장치 | |
KR19980027713A (ko) * | 1996-10-17 | 1998-07-15 | 김광호 | 이레이저 정정 능력을 갖는 리드-솔로몬 부호의 복호 장치 및 방법 |
KR19980059945A (ko) * | 1996-12-31 | 1998-10-07 | 구자홍 | 에러정정 장치 및 방법 |
KR19980059974A (ko) * | 1996-12-31 | 1998-10-07 | 구자홍 | 이종 광 디스크 에러정정 회로 |
KR19980065723A (ko) * | 1997-01-14 | 1998-10-15 | 김광호 | 디지탈 비디오 디스크 시스템의 데이타 처리 방법 및 장치 |
Also Published As
Publication number | Publication date |
---|---|
KR20030073531A (ko) | 2003-09-19 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
KR100856399B1 (ko) | 디코딩 방법 및 그 장치 | |
US6751771B2 (en) | Method and apparatus for error processing in optical disk memories | |
US8166369B2 (en) | Method for error processing in optical disk memories | |
KR100734262B1 (ko) | 광 저장 매체의 최적화된 결함 처리를 위한 결함 판단 장치 | |
US6378103B1 (en) | Apparatus and method for error correction in optical disk system | |
US7058875B2 (en) | Method of correcting data on a high-density recording medium | |
US6631492B2 (en) | Multitrack data recording and read out of recorded multitrack digital data for error correction | |
KR100505210B1 (ko) | 에러 정정장치 및 방법 | |
US7213190B2 (en) | Data processing apparatus and method | |
CN100394506C (zh) | 纠错装置及方法 | |
KR100209676B1 (ko) | 에러정정 장치 및 방법 | |
KR100467270B1 (ko) | 에러 정정장치 및 방법 | |
JP3337034B2 (ja) | データ伝送方法 | |
JP2904140B2 (ja) | 光記録媒体 | |
KR20010100509A (ko) | 고밀도 광 기록매체에서의 데이터 에러정정 코드생성방법과 이에 의한 에러 정정 방법, 그리고 그 장치 | |
JP3476014B2 (ja) | データ処理方法 | |
US7134043B2 (en) | DVD EDC check system and method without descrambling sector data | |
JP3360627B2 (ja) | 記録装置および情報記録方法 | |
JP3360628B2 (ja) | 再生装置、情報再生方法 | |
JP2006164503A (ja) | 光学媒体上の欠陥領域を決定する装置及び方法 | |
JP3360629B2 (ja) | 記録装置および情報記録方法 | |
JP2003173633A (ja) | 光ディスク装置 | |
KR20040068666A (ko) | 광디스크의 에러 정정 방법 | |
JP2002074861A (ja) | ディジタルデータ再生装置及び再生方法 | |
JPH11238326A (ja) | 再生装置 |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A201 | Request for examination | ||
PA0109 | Patent application |
Patent event code: PA01091R01D Comment text: Patent Application Patent event date: 20020312 |
|
PA0201 | Request for examination | ||
N231 | Notification of change of applicant | ||
PN2301 | Change of applicant |
Patent event date: 20020603 Comment text: Notification of Change of Applicant Patent event code: PN23011R01D |
|
PG1501 | Laying open of application | ||
E902 | Notification of reason for refusal | ||
PE0902 | Notice of grounds for rejection |
Comment text: Notification of reason for refusal Patent event date: 20050107 Patent event code: PE09021S01D |
|
E701 | Decision to grant or registration of patent right | ||
PE0701 | Decision of registration |
Patent event code: PE07011S01D Comment text: Decision to Grant Registration Patent event date: 20050720 |
|
GRNT | Written decision to grant | ||
PR0701 | Registration of establishment |
Comment text: Registration of Establishment Patent event date: 20050725 Patent event code: PR07011E01D |
|
PR1002 | Payment of registration fee |
Payment date: 20050726 End annual number: 3 Start annual number: 1 |
|
PG1601 | Publication of registration | ||
LAPS | Lapse due to unpaid annual fee | ||
PC1903 | Unpaid annual fee |
Termination category: Default of registration fee Termination date: 20090610 |